Bethany A. Bradley is a scholar working on Ecological Modeling, Ecology and Nature and Landscape Conservation. According to data from OpenAlex, Bethany A. Bradley has authored 132 papers receiving a total of 9.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 67 papers in Ecological Modeling, 66 papers in Ecology and 54 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ation. Recurrent topics in Bethany A. Bradley's work include Species Distribution and Climate Change (67 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(52 papers) and Rangeland and Wildlife Management (40 papers). Bethany A. Bradley is often cited by papers focused on Species Distribution and Climate Change (67 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(52 papers) and Rangeland and Wildlife Management (40 papers). Bethany A. Bradley coll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Spain. Bethany A. Bradley's co-authors include Jennifer K. Balch, John F. Mustard, David S. Wilcove, Emily J. Fusco, Dana M. Blumenthal, John T. Abatzoglou, Carla M. D’Antonio, Cascade J. B. Sorte, R. Chelsea Nagy and Michael Oppenheimer and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nature Communications and S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ología.
